ZIP Code 45304
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Darke County, Ohio.

Covering part of Darke County, Ohio, ZIP Code 45304 has about 7,624 residents. Its median household income of $72,014 runs above the Darke County figure of $64,654.
Between 2019 and 2023, ZIP Code 45304's population grew 4.4% from 7,305 to 7,624, while its median gross rent rose 14.1% from $709 to $809.
White (non-Hispanic) residents are the largest group, 96.9% of the population. 85.0% of workers drive to work alone.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 7,305 | $71,680 | $143,000 | $709 |
| 2020 | 7,073 | $61,046 | $143,700 | $699 |
| 2021 | 7,315 | $61,793 | $149,400 | $763 |
| 2022 | 7,617 | $63,911 | $177,200 | $805 |
| 2023 | 7,624 | $72,014 | $190,000 | $809 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
